Abstract
We report significant enhancement of THz-radiation from InAs under magnetic field irradiated with femtosecond pulses. Furthermore, the radiation spectrum is found to be controlled by the excitation pulsewidth, chirp direction of the excitation pulse, and the magnetic field.
